          Naypyitaw is a strange place. The hotel was nearly completely empty as were the majority of the hotels in the city. That was a little unnerving at first. However the staff were very friendly and accommodating. They helped us rent a motorcycle to get around. (there is zero public transportation in Naypyitaw so a motorcycle is incredibly useful) They also helped us book the next leg of our trip to Inle Lake. The breakfast was good. There is a nice well maintained pool too. No complaints!

          Empty hotel cuz of Nay Pyi Taw not the problem of hotel. Great staff, great breakfask. great pool just for me and my friend. even u order from hotel, its a little bit pricy but with good quanlity. we rent the semi motorbike for 10000 for 12 hours from the hotel. and didnt find any other motorbike rental shop. If u wanna book bus ticket from there. Be aware that the bus usually gonna stop on every small town and city. if u dont enjoy.the slow bus, better check with the staff if there is a direct and express bus. the funny thing is even though the bus is called express bus, but its still stop everywhere on the road. second, if u book the taxi service to the bus station, better make sure the staff totally understand this request.

          Hotel Aye Chan Thar was a lovely hotel with very attentive staff and few guests. Though the pool was unavailable one day of our stay, the gym was available. The staff spoke a range of English, but tried very hard to fulfill any request. They were easily able to call for a taxi, apologized about the pool, and made sure our room was cleaned daily. The room was nice, with the exception of the very short shower. There was a balcony, but no chairs for landing. An electric kettle was present, but no tea or coffee were provided. However, breakfast was available from 6:30-9 AM, and was very good. The location of the hotel is quite far from the center of the city, but only about a 20-minute drive due to the complete lack of traffic. It is about 30 minutes from the Safari Park, Zoological Gardens, National Landmark Gardens, and military museum. It's a definite value for the money.

          Our stay in this hotel was... Odd. We seemed to be the only guests staying there, but our room was in the smaller building in the back, on the ground floor. There was a big stain on the wall next to our door, and the washroom wasn't very clean. The pool had water, but it was dirty. There was a nice gym, though, which was the best part. The hotel just felt deserted; it's far from city 'centre' (it costs 8000 MMK for a taxi to go there) like all the other northern hotels. At night, it felt creepy being alone in that separate building, in the middle of a long street of deserted mammoth hotels. That's Naypyidaw for you, I guess. The staff tried to be as helpful as possible, and we're very grateful they arranged our onwards taxi and bus. But there were about three staff per guest, and they didn't give us enough space while we were eating or lounging. Also, only a couple of them understood English well, so we were passed from staff until we were understood. Not bad, but not good.
